[0012] The present invention will be further introduced below in conjunction with accompanying drawing and embodiment: the method of the present invention is divided into four modules altogether.

[0013] Part 1: Automatic pre-labeling of knowledge points

[0014] The function of the knowledge point automatic pre-marking module is to associate the key and difficult knowledge point vocabulary specified by the teacher in the corresponding chapter of the courseware with the multimedia courseware, and mark the knowledge points in the multimedia audio file of the courseware through the keyword recognition technology based on the hidden Markov model The exact moment of occurrence in . This module can pre-retrieve the knowledge points in the course and locate the specific moment when they appear in the multimedia courseware before the user searches, and can quickly provide pre-marked results when the user searches. Abstract

The invention provides a multimedia courseware retrieval system based on voice keyword recognition. Firstly, a backstage converts pre-provided text knowledge points into voice models, courseware is labeled by a voice recognizing technique based on a hidden markov model to locate the accurate positions of the knowledge points in the multimedia courseware, and a reverse index based on keywords is constructed and maintained in an index module. When a user inputs text keywords in a prompt box to inquire, results in the index are extracted to be displayed to the user if the keywords are previously labeled. If the keywords are not labeled, the system can retrieve the courseware in real time, waits for feedback of the user to the results and makes statistics for the feedback information. Self-adaption training is carried out on the keywords to label the courseware again and upgrade the indexes. Compared with a traditional network course learning style system, the courseware retrieval system can quickly search for and locate the keywords of the knowledge points, improves retrieval accuracy through user interaction and finally improves the learning efficiency of students effectively.

technical field [0001] The invention relates to the field of multimedia technology, in particular to a keyword-based audio retrieval method and system for multimedia courseware. Background technique [0002] In recent years, with the advancement of technology, a large number of voices have been collected and recorded and preserved in the form of audio. Among them, due to the needs of lifelong learning and network teaching, more and more multimedia audio courseware has appeared on the Internet. However, with the rapid increase of multimedia courseware, learners are faced with a large amount of teaching audio materials. If they want to find the knowledge points they want to learn, they often need to watch the materials they want to find what they need. This creates a lot of trouble for learners.
